Marco Salemi is Assistant Professor at the Department of Pathology, Immunology and Laboratory Medicine of the University of Florida School of Medicine, Gainesville, USA. His research focuses on molecular evolution of viruses by integrating molecular biology and computational approaches. He has been an EMBO Fellow and a Marie-Curie Fellow in the Evolutionary Biology Group at the Department of Zoology, University of Oxford. The book has a stronger focus on hypothesis testing than the previous edition, with more extensive discussions on recombination analysis, detecting molecular adaptation and genealogy-based population genetics. This second edition includes seven new chapters, covering topics such as Bayesian inference, tree topology testing, and the impact of recombination on phylogenies. The Phylogenetic Handbook provides a comprehensive introduction to theory and practice of nucleotide and protein phylogenetic analysis.
